换新项目idea里面的git提交为啥老项目
时间: 2023-08-31 21:57:38 浏览: 44
在项目中使用Git进行版本控制是一个很常见的实践,而提交的代码通常是当前项目的代码。如果在新项目的Git提交中出现了老项目的代码,可能是因为以下几个原因:
1. 混淆了项目目录:在使用Git提交代码时,可能会不小心将老项目和新项目的代码目录混淆,导致将老项目的代码误提交到了新项目的Git仓库中。
2. 复制粘贴错误:在复制粘贴代码时,可能会不小心将老项目的代码片段复制到了新项目中,并且被提交到了Git仓库中。
3. 分支切换错误:如果你在同一个本地Git仓库中同时处理多个项目,可能会出现分支切换错误的情况,导致将老项目的代码提交到了新项目的分支中。
为了避免这种情况发生,你可以采取以下措施:
1. 确认当前所处的项目目录,确保你在正确的项目目录下进行Git操作。
2. 注意复制粘贴操作,确保只复制和粘贴当前项目的代码。
3. 在使用多个项目的情况下,确保正确切换分支,并且仔细核对要提交的代码是否属于当前项目。
希望以上解答能够帮到你!如果还有其他问题,请随时提问。
相关问题
idea为已有项目配置git
好的,为已有项目配置 Git 的步骤如下:
1. 在项目根目录下打开命令行工具,执行 `git init` 命令,将该目录初始化为 Git 仓库。
2. 执行 `git add .` 命令,将项目中所有文件添加到 Git 的暂存区。
3. 执行 `git commit -m "Initial commit"` 命令,将暂存区中的文件提交到本地 Git 仓库,并添加一条提交信息。
4. 在 Git 服务器上创建一个新的仓库,获取该仓库的 URL。
5. 执行 `git remote add origin <仓库 URL>` 命令,将本地 Git 仓库与远程仓库关联。
6. 执行 `git push -u origin master` 命令,将本地 Git 仓库中的代码推送到远程仓库。
idea使用git导入项目
要使用Git导入项目,您可以按照以下步骤进行操作:
1. 在本地创建一个新的Git仓库。打开命令行终端,进入到项目的根目录,并运行以下命令:
```
git init
```
2. 将远程仓库克隆到本地。找到您想要导入的项目的Git仓库地址,并运行以下命令:
```
git clone <远程仓库地址>
```
3. 进入到项目目录中:
```
cd <项目目录>
```
4. 可选:如果项目有多个分支,可以切换到您所需的分支:
```
git checkout <分支名称>
```
5. 开始进行项目开发或修改。在您完成代码的修改后,可以通过以下命令将更改添加到暂存区:
```
git add .
```
6. 提交更改。运行以下命令将更改提交到本地仓库:
```
git commit -m "提交说明"
```
7. 如果您是在已经创建了远程仓库的情况下导入项目,可以使用以下命令将本地仓库与远程仓库关联起来:
```
git remote add origin <远程仓库地址>
```
8. 将本地更改推送到远程仓库:
```
git push origin <分支名称>
```
这样,您就成功地将项目导入到Git中并与远程仓库关联起来了。您可以使用Git的其他命令来管理和协作开发项目。